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could induce it to roll.

2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things should not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and ensure you lock it when you are done.

4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y objects to the dumpster.

6. Just let adults close to the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they are able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Be sure to have plenty of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as high as you like, as long as you don't load it higher than the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or heavy dumpsters are just not safe, and companies don't carry dangerous loads to be able to safeguard motorists and passengers on the road.

In some regions,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. If your load is too high, it WOn't have the ability to be tarped so you will need to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might lead to additional fees if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Remember to keep your load no higher than the sides of the dumpster, and you will be fine.

What is the smallest size dumpster available?

The smallest size roll-off dumpster typically available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small-scale jobs, for example modest home c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function well for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of trash Be constantly aware that weight limitations for the containers are demanded,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The standard we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in will allow you to take care of little jobs around the home. If you have a larger project coming up, take a look at some larger containers also.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to put most sorts of debris into a dumpster rental in Pound Ridge.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ental danger,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ental company if you are uncertain.

That leaves most forms of debris that you could put in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any sort of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Specific types of satisfactory deb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you need to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.


What if I have to maintain a dumpster longer than 7 days?

Most dumpster rental firms in Pound Ridge normally rent containers for a standard speed for 7 days, although most one time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you phone to reserve the container, discussion with the customer service representative about the duration of time you believe you will need.

If it turns out that your project takes longer than you anticipated, just telephone the dumpster company to describe. Most firms will bill you on a per-day basis after your initial 7 days. It is very important to convey this added demand when you understand you've it since most dumpster businesses have a limited number of bins that could already be allowed. Most firms will work together with you to adapt your additional rental time. Should you believe you'll need the dumpster for an additional week or more, make sure to mention that; rates may change based on a longer time frame.
